Find a Lawyer in MarsaxlokkAbout White Collar Crime Law in Marsaxlokk, Malta:
White Collar Crime refers to non-violent crimes committed by individuals or businesses for financial gain. In Marsaxlokk, Malta, White Collar Crimes may include fraud, embezzlement, bribery, money laundering, and insider trading. These crimes are often complex and require specialized legal knowledge to navigate.

Local Laws Overview:
In Malta, White Collar Crimes are governed by various laws, such as the Prevention of Money Laundering Act, the Criminal Code, and the Companies Act. It is important to understand the specific provisions of these laws to ensure compliance and avoid legal repercussions.

4. Can I be held personally liable for White Collar Crime committed by my company?
In certain cases, individuals can be held personally liable for White Collar Crimes committed by their company, especially if they were directly involved in the criminal activity. Consulting with a lawyer can help clarify your liability.
5. How can I report suspected White Collar Crimes in Marsaxlokk, Malta?
You can report suspected White Collar Crimes to the relevant authorities, such as the Malta Financial Services Authority, the police, or the Office of the Attorney General.
6. What are the common defense strategies for White Collar Crime cases?
Common defense strategies for White Collar Crime cases may include lack of intent, entrapment, mistake of fact, or insufficient evidence. A lawyer can assess your case and recommend the most suitable defense strategy.
